Output 112a17f97395f60f6ae8ef3da7579179e465a0a74cb64dd8951ce4fb8eb50efa:0

value
1623718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c30775e10dc65b5b6311d67f81a03d7c207542 OP_EQUAL
address
3Dya77R2zYpmoRkLHok44J9s9ezfgL9rhX
transaction
112a17f97395f60f6ae8ef3da7579179e465a0a74cb64dd8951ce4fb8eb50efa
confirmations
262612
spent
true